Abu Dhabi: The transit visa rules for the United Kingdom have changed effective December 1, officials at the UK Embassy in Dubai said.

Under the new rules, when Emirati, Omani, or Qatari nationals are transiting landside — for example, arriving at one airport and leaving from another or passing through border control to collect luggage for connecting flights — then they must hold a valid Electronic Visa Waiver [EVW] document.

As an EVW permits single entry only, a separate EVW is needed for each landside transit, said the embassy in a statement.

Otherwise one must be a UK visitor on a transit visa or must have a valid UK visa.

Travellers must have a valid document and arrive and depart the UK by air or have a confirmed onward flight which leaves the UK by 23.59 hours the day after they arrive in the UK.

They must also have the proper documents for the destination such as a visa for destination country.
